In a study of 25 smokers who tried to quit smoking with nicotine patch therapy, 14 were smoking one year after the treatment. Use the sign test with a 0.01 significance level to test the claim that among smokers who try to quit with nicotine patch therapy, the majority are smoking a year after the treatment.



Identify the correct HYPOTHESES used in a hypothesis test of the claim.

a. H0: p = 0.5

H1: p < 0.5 b. H0: median = 0.5

H1: median < 0.5 c. H0: p = 0.5

H1: p > 0.5 d. H0: median = 0.5

H1: median > 0.5

Explanation / Answer

The hypothesis testing for the following should be to check the mean probability among smokers who try to quit with nicotine patch therapy, the majority are smoking a year after the treatment.

so., p>0.5 is the hypothesis under test where p is the probability among smokers who try to quit with nicotine patch therapy

So., C

The null hypothesis here is Ho: p = 0.5

and the alternative hypothesis is H1: p>0.5
